WHAT YOU WILL LEARN:  This guided walking tour will help participants to learn the unique cultural legacy of Waikīkī.  We will explore the lives of Hawaii’s leaders in both ancient and modern times.  We will visit it's many historic sites, discuss important people, and historic events that helped to shape Waikīkī into what we see it as today.  Participants will build an awareness of the significance of the “Wahi Pana” of Waikīkī  as both a sacred place to Hawaiians and a living history in the modern world.  It is our kuleana (responsibility) as hosts of our place to understand and know the lineage of our historical leaders, their cultural legacy, and how their decisions impact our community in modern times.
